Dynamics 365 Application Development

This is the code repository for Dynamics 365 Application Development, published by Packt. It contains all the supporting project files necessary to work through the book from start to finish.

About the Book

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M is the most trusted name in enterprise-level customer relationship management. Thelatest version of Dynamics CRM comes with the important addition of exciting features guaranteed to make your life easier. It comes straight off the shelf with a whole new frontier of updated business rules, process enhancements, SDK methods, and other enhancements.

Instructions and Navigation

All of the code is organized into folders. Each folder starts with a number followed by the application name. For example, Chapter02.

The book is based on UI testing only chapter 08 has code files.

The code will look like the following:

Request: GET [Organization URI] /api/data/v9.0/contacts?
  $select=firstname&$top=5
  Accept: application/json
  OData-MaxVersion: 4.0
  OData-Version: 4.0

This book assumes that the reader has some basic knowledge of Dynamics CRM and would like to learn the new features introduced in Dynamics 365. However, someone who hasn’t worked with the previous versions and is starting afresh with Dynamics 365 will equally benefit from it. Developers, customizers, administrators, and power users will be able to enhance their skills by learning about the latest features and changes introduced in Dynamics 365.

You can try out all the features and topics mentioned in the book using a trial instance of Dynamics 365 (https://trials.dynamics.com/) along with the free community edition of Visual Studio 2017 (https://www.visualstudio.com/vs/community/). Some of the topics covered do not apply to the on-premise version of Dynamics 365
